~jan0sch/smederee
~jan0sch/smederee/modules/hub/src/universal/conf/smederee-hub.service.sample
~jan0sch/smederee/modules/hub/src/universal/conf/smederee-hub.service.sample
0 | [Unit] |
1 | Description=Smederee Hub Service - Software collaboration platform. |
2 | Requires=network.target |
3 |
|
4 | [Service] |
5 | Type=simple |
6 | WorkingDirectory=/usr/local/share/smederee-hub |
7 | EnvironmentFile=/etc/default/smederee-hub |
8 | ExecStart=/usr/local/share/smederee-hub/bin/hub |
9 | ExecReload=/bin/kill -HUP $MAINPID |
10 | Restart=always |
11 | RestartSec=60 |
12 | SuccessExitStatus= |
13 | TimeoutStopSec=5 |
14 | User=smederee |
15 | ExecStartPre=/bin/mkdir -p /run/hub |
16 | ExecStartPre=/bin/chown smederee:smederee /run/hub |
17 | ExecStartPre=/bin/chmod 755 /run/hub |
18 | PermissionsStartOnly=true |
19 | LimitNOFILE=1024 |
20 |
|
21 | [Install] |
22 | WantedBy=multi-user.target |